Had a wonderful lunch - food was absolutely fantastic and service was 5 star.\n\nDo not walk by this restaurant - get a high end... meal at Applebee\'s prices.\n\nMy wife and I stopped in on a whim. We both enjoy \"risking\" a new restaurant, and so westopped in.\n\nFirst, the service was excellent. We felt like family; great care was taken to explain the menu.\n\nOur mealswere awesome.\n\nMy wife had the beef Chautas, a traditional Peruvian rice dish. The beef was tender and full of flavor. Therice was perfectly seasond, and all vegetables were fresh and well prepared. Everything about the dish was focused on her...from preparation to presentation.\n\nI had a \"Miami Beach\" themed Peruvian dish. Based upon the classic Peruvian LomoSaltado, the Lomo A La Huancaina added a creamy sauce and noodles vice rice. It was amazing. The flavors were perfectlybalanced.\n\nEverything about our meal was memorable. We understand a seasonal change to the menu is upcoming. I know thatwhat ever is on the menu will be just as wonderful.\n\nTake time and support an up and coming chef. PISCO 51 is a greataddition to the regions food adventure.\n\nNow, stop reading and start eating! :-) Read more

Great food experience. I really was not familiar with Peruvian cuisine. I did not know there was a Japanese influence on their... cooking. The waitress was very helpful and friendly. My favorite was the ceviche. The portions are generous. If you are lookingfor something out of the ordinary, this is a food journey you should take. They have a nice purple drink made from purple cornit is non-alcoholic and from what I understand is also good with rum. Read more

We\'ve recently discovered Peruvian food, so were excited to learn of Pisco 51. Chef Pedro has developed an amazing menu, and... says new items are being added soon. We went with friends & started with a round of regular (if you can call them that) PiscoSours, and variety of appetizers to share: Causa Rellena, creamy ceviche, yuca a la Huancaina. For dinner, we enjoyed LomoSaltado and Lomo a la Huancaino and a flight of flavored Pisco Sours with barista style art: llamas, the word Peru, etc. Everylast thing was delicious. We will be back to try the rest of the menu. Chef Pedro and his wife were delightful to talk to, aswas our server. TRY THIS PLACE! Read more
